21 definitions found

  • amphiphile — n. (Chemistry) A chemical compound which has both hydrophilic…
  • amphophile — n. An amphophilic cell.
  • haplophase — n. (Biology) The haploid phase in the life cycle of an organism.
  • haplophyte — adj. (Genetics) Having the normal number of chromosomes characteristic… — n. Such an organism.
  • hippophile — n. A person who loves horses.
  • hoplophobe — n. (Derogatory, rare) Someone who has an irrational fear of guns.
  • hyperphyll — n. (Botany) A distal part of a sprout or a leaf.
  • lophophine — n. 3-methoxy-4,5-methylenedioxyphenethylamine, a putative psychedelic…
  • lophophore — n. (Zoology) A feeding organ of brachiopods, bryozoans and phoronids.
  • ophiophile — n. (Rare) A person who loves snakes.
  • phaeophyll — n. (Biochemistry) The carotenoid pigment of brown algae, mostly…
  • philophobe — n. Someone who suffers from philophobia; someone who fears falling in love.
  • philosophe — n. Any of the leading philosophers or intellectuals of the 18th-century… — n. (Derogatory) An incompetent philosopher; a philosophaster.
  • phospholes — n. Plural of phosphole.
  • photophile — n. (Biology) Any organism that thrives in bright sunlight.
  • phytophile — n. (Biology) Any organism that thrives around plants. — n. A person who is especially interested in plants.
  • shinhopple — n. The hobblebush.
  • taphophile — n. A person who is interested in cemeteries, funerals and gravestones.
